Part Number: FT-E037U

EPON ONU with 1-PON Port and 24 10/100M ports

FT-E037U series is F-tone company access to applications for large-scale carrier-grade EPON FTTB ONU equipment, the series follows the IEEE 802.3-2005 comprehensive EPON equipment and technical requirementss of China Telecom V2.1, unified, open software and hardware architecture provide a powerful network management capabilities, to achieve a flexible network and management system, with telecom-grade operations, manageability and easy to maintain. Provide users with fiber to the building (FTTB, Fiber To The Building) solutions.

Product features:
Conform to IEEE802.3ah standard and meet CTC V2.1 technical requirements
Support Ethernet service layer 2 switching and wire-speed forwarding of uplink and downlink services
Support frame filtering and suppression
Support standard 802.1Q Vlan function, support VLAN conversion
Support 4094 VLANs (802.1Q)
Support Dynamic Bandwidth Allocation (DBA) function
Support QoS, including traffic flow classification, priority marking, queue and dispatch, traffic shaping and traffic control, etc
Single ONU supports up to 8 LLID.
Support IGMP Snooping
Support Ethernet port ratelimit loop detection
Support power failure alarm
Support lightning protection for power supply and lightning protection for service port
Port features:
1 PON ports (1.25G)
24 10/100M port
Physical features:
Physical dimension: 440*207*43.6 (L×W×H, unit: mm)
Power supply:100-240VAC
Power consumption: 22W
Temperature:
Working temperature: -10℃~+55℃;
Storage temperature: -30℃~+60℃;
Relative humidity: 10℃~+90℃ (non-condensing)
